Abbott VRK results

I had the rescue kit installed in two phases-the steering brace first, then the suspension bushings. I have not installed the subframe brace yet-I'm not sure I want to lose another inch+ of ground clearance.
The result (drum roll): 2/3 of the torque/braking/road steer are removed. The leftover 1/3 is still obnoxious, but much better. I am much more confident driving the car.
You have to keep the tire pressures up to keep things right. I was fooled by the recently cooling temperatures and had to touch up pressures (42psi front, 38 rear). Any comments on that?
The steering brace gave half the improvement, bushings the other half.
I think the basic problem, aside from soft stock bushings and steering rack mount, is that the rack is mounted on the body and the suspension arms are on the subframe, which can deflect against the body, such that the steering rack is not in direct connection with the suspension. My C900 has no such intermediate subframe to wiggle, and does not have road or braking steer.
I am thinking of testing this theory by buying a set of subframe mounts and welding them solid. Replacing the current mounts with these won't harm anything in the short term but be a good test. Probably will transmit more engine vibration of course. If this is the problem I'll try to design mounts that flex vertically so as to not transmit vibration, but are trapped laterally to fix steering shifts.
Any thoughts?
